本文介绍了一款 npm 包 emoji-unicode-to-name 的使用教程。该包可以将 emoji 的 Unicode 码转换为对应的 emoji 名称,方便我们在项目中使用 emoji 并且便于阅读代码。
什么是 emoji-unicode-to-name
emoji-unicode-to-name 是一款可以将 emoji 的 Unicode 码转换为对应的 emoji 名称的 npm 包。使用该包可以方便地在项目中使用 emoji,并且便于阅读代码。
安装
我们可以通过 npm 安装 emoji-unicode-to-name。
npm install emoji-unicode-to-name
使用方法
安装完成后,在代码中引入包即可使用。
const { unicodeToName } = require('emoji-unicode-to-name') const emojiUnicode = '1F600' // Unicode 码 const emojiName = unicodeToName(emojiUnicode) // 将 Unicode 码转换为对应的 emoji 名称 console.log(emojiName) // "GRINNING FACE"
详细说明
在使用过程中,我们需要先了解一些关于 emoji 的知识。
emoji 的 Unicode 码
每个 emoji 都有一个对应的 Unicode 码,可以使用该码在代码中表示该 emoji。例如,“😄”对应的 Unicode 码为“1F600”。
emoji 的名称
每个 emoji 还有一个对应的名称,可以使用该名称在代码中表示该 emoji。例如,“😄”对应的名称为“GRINNING FACE”。
使用示例
下面是一个使用 emoji-unicode-to-name 包的示例:
const { unicodeToName } = require('emoji-unicode-to-name') const emojiUnicode = '1F600' // Unicode 码 const emojiName = unicodeToName(emojiUnicode) // 将 Unicode 码转换为对应的 emoji 名称 console.log(emojiName) // "GRINNING FACE"
总结
通过本文,我们了解了 npm 包 emoji-unicode-to-name 的使用方法,以及如何将 emoji 的 Unicode 码转换为对应的名称。使用该包可以方便地在项目中使用 emoji,并且便于阅读代码。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600575d781e8991b448ea7d6